Paver Patio Cost by Size in Lehi
| Project Size (sqft) | Paver Patio | Retaining Wall | Sod Installation |
|---|---|---|---|
| 200 sq ft | $4,050 | $6,700 | $250 |
| 400 sq ft | $8,050 | $13,450 | $550 |
| 600 sq ft | $12,100 | $20,150 | $800 |
| 800 sq ft | $16,100 | $26,850 | $1,050 |
| 1,000 sq ft | $20,150 | $33,550 | $1,350 |

What pitfalls should I watch for hiring a landscaper in Lehi's HOA neighborhoods?
Check that any Lehi contractor doing landscaping project carries both general liability insurance ($1M minimum) and workers' compensation. Request certificates directly from the insurer, not just copies the contractor provides. In Lehi, verify your landscaping project contractor pulls the permit themselves — never pull it in your own name. If they ask you to pull the permit, they may not be properly licensed to do the work. Lehi's rapid growth attracts out-of-state contractors who follow the boom. Verify any unfamiliar company's local licensing, physical address, and track record. Fly-by-night operations leave when the market cools.
